In its annual report, the Commission for Conciliation, Mediation and Arbitration (CCMA) has revealed that out of 38,588 potential retrenchments, the commission was able to save 15,787 of those jobs.
CCMA Director Cameron Morajane says some of these disputes can be prevented and one job lost is one too many. Morajane says job losses are mostly due to technology or economics
